Why Inglewood’s Climate & Housing Affect Garage Door
Inglewood sits 3–4 miles east of the Pacific coast, and the daily marine layer cycles — dense morning fog burning off to afternoon sun — drive moisture into weatherstripping, bottom seals, and unfinished wood door sections faster than in drier inland LA suburbs. The salt-laden coastal air also accelerates oxidation on torsion springs and galvanized tracks, shortening hardware replacement intervals noticeably compared to cities like Torrance further inland.
The housing stock compounds these conditions. Inglewood’s residential neighborhoods are dominated by post-WWII tract homes built between roughly 1945 and 1965, most featuring single-car garages with 8–9 ft openings that cannot accommodate modern full-size pickups or SUVs, making door-width upsizing a frequent job. Many of these garages retain original wood-panel doors or early-generation steel doors that are now well past their service life and lack modern safety reverse sensors. Pricing for Garage Door in Inglewood
We don’t quote blind over the phone, but here’s what Inglewood homeowners typically pay based on 22 years of local invoices:
| Service |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Spring replacement (torsion, single door) | $180 – $260 |
| Spring replacement (torsion, double door) | $240 – $340 |
| Opener repair (gear, sensor, circuit) | $150 – $280 |
| Opener installation (new unit, standard) | $380 – $580 |
| Single-car door replacement (installed) | $850 – $1,400 |
| Double-car door replacement (installed) | $1,200 – $2,200 |
| Emergency service call (after-hours) | $95 – $150 + parts |
